Robert Barry – Take Your Time to Sit Down for a Moment and Read a Book



Robert Barry – Taking Your Time

18 February – 28 April 2012

MFC – Michèle Didier
66 Rue Notre-Dame de Nazareth
75003 Paris

Exhibition of all the editions by Robert Barry published by Michèle Didier.
Also shown are more than 25 books, collected by Robert Barry between 1966 and 2008, which are related to time, placed on a table, the 'Time Table', and also duplicates of specific pages are displayed on the wall.

List of books chosen by Robert Barry:
